Decree from Putin: the number of the Russian army increased

The number of military personnel in the Russian Armed Forces has increased by approximately 170,000 people.

Axar.az reports that Russian President Vladimir Putin signed a corresponding decree.

Thus, according to the document, the number of staff of the armed forces was determined to be 2,209,130 ​​people, including 1,320,000 military personnel.

In the previous decree, this number was 2 million 39 thousand 758 people, including 1 million 150 thousand 628 military personnel.
